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
336958082 4088 219296027 237781 0524824
59 39
59 39
385767 01467 168656 846817 0909
All about undefined
Interested in learning more?
59 39
385767 01467 168656 846817 0909
See more
7849 73126
74 89767520110 98875355179 9383
See more
16 74 48241
457 171 740756596
See more